Announcing Our First Impact Labs Cohort on Zero Hunger: Addressing Food Insecurity in the U.S.

Saleforce Nonprofit

In 2021, 53 million Americans turned to food banks and community programs for help putting food on the table. Food insecurity threatens to worsen as households continue to face setbacks due to COVID-19, fears of a global recession, and the highest increase in inflation rates and food prices seen in the last 40 years.
